America, China and Thucydides' Trap. Will the twenty-first century be defined by the inevitability of conflict between China and the USA? When Athens went to war with Sparta some 2,500 years ago, the Greek historian Thucydides identified one simple cause, a rising power threatened to displace a ruling one, leading to conflict. Today, the same structural forces propel China and the United States toward a cataclysm of unseen proportions, even as both sides insist that such a war could never occur. The author also discusses the rare instances when two clashing powers have avoided disaster.
